Context & Surroundings

Pinoso, officially El Pinós, is a traditional town in the mountainous interior of Alicante province, near the border with Murcia. Covering 126 km² and with a population of 7,300, the town exudes an authentic Spanish atmosphere, known for its production of wine, salt, and marble. The plot is situated in an urban area where amenities like a supermarket and a restaurant are within a 2 km radius. Its elevation of 574 meters above sea level ensures a temperate climate, with average temperatures ranging from 8°C to 26°C and over 3,800 hours of sunshine per year. This means summer months are pleasantly warm, with a swimming season lasting approximately four months. The numerous local festivals contribute to the vibrant culture. Although the median income in the province is lower than in coastal areas, tourism in Pinoso is steadily growing, indicating potential regional development.

Nature & Climate

Alt text: Single-story office building with large windows, paved parking area, and surrounding greenery.

Pinoso enjoys a Mediterranean climate with dry, warm summers and mild winters. The average annual temperature is around 15.8°C, with temperatures varying from 8°C to 26°C throughout the year. With historically 3,842 hours of sunshine annually, the region is very sunny. The swimming season, when water temperature is at least 20°C, lasts about four months. The altitude of 574 meters above sea level contributes to the moderate temperatures. The landscape is hilly and characterized by agriculture, particularly vineyards, adding to the region's rural charm.

Area Guide: Pinoso

Pinoso, officially Pinoso / El Pinós is a traditional town which sits located in the mountainous countryside of the Alicante/Murcia border. This traditional town is renowned for the production of fine wines, rock salt and marble. Pinoso has a population of 7,300 and a municipal area of 126 km2. Recently it has experienced a growth in tourism.

Climate

Month Avg. Temperature Rainfall
January 7.9°C 30 mm
February 8.4°C 25 mm
March 11.4°C 34 mm
April 14.0°C 37 mm
May 17.2°C 42 mm
June 22.0°C 19 mm
July 25.4°C 5 mm
August 25.6°C 8 mm
September 21.6°C 31 mm
October 16.7°C 40 mm
November 11.8°C 35 mm
December 8.3°C 28 mm
